Bedroom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ak in a contained area | Yes | No | You can likely handle a small leak with a mop and some towels. |
| Large water leak or flood | No | Yes | Professionals have the equipment and expertise to handle large-scale water removal and restoration. |
| Water damage to structural elements (e.g., walls, floors) | No | Yes | Structural damage needs specialized expertise and equipment to prevent further problems. |
| Mold growth or musty odors | No | Yes | Professionals have the equipment and expertise to safely remove mold and remove musty odors. |
| Water damage to electrical systems or appliances | No | Yes | Electrical systems and appliances need specialized handling to prevent further damage or electrical shock. |
| Water damage to sensitive items (e.g., electronics, furniture) | No | Yes | Professionals have the expertise and equipment to safely restore sensitive items. |

Bedroom Water Removal Cost In Lakewood Village, FL
The cost of bedroom water removal in Lakewood Village, FL will depend on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common scenarios: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Restoration and re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Scope of work, materials required, and labor costs |
| Mold remediation |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of mold, and required equipment |
| Dehumidification and air purification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ment required, and duration of treatment |
| Water damage assessment and planning | $100 – $500 | Scope of work, complexity of assessment, and required expertise |
| Disinfection and sanitizing |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ment required, and duration of treatment |
